Hebrew word study

קַרְתָּהQartâh Kartah, a place in Palestine

Pronounced “kar-taw'

Kartah, a place in Palestine

Translated in the King James as: Kartah.

Origin: from H7176 (קֶרֶת); city;

Read it in context & ask Abram about this word

Where it appears

Joshua 1×
Joshua 21:34
